As usual I am updating with the latest announced devices...some recently announced at the IFA event. (Click images to view specs on GSM-Arena)
Starting with the Xperia SL the upgrade to my old Xperia S with an overclocked processor at 1.7GHz.
Then the triplets...Xperia T, TX and V respectively...because they all have 13MP cameras...though some key specs separate them otherwise:

The mid-ranger Xperia J:
Sony is releasing the T and J on September 5 almost a first for the company so soon after release. Read more on that here.

I like the fact that they have dropped the design with the transparent bar at the bottom it wasn't an aesthetic some people liked. They are reverting to the Sony Ericsson Xperia Arc design style...with the slight curve.
